The Tampa DUI lawyer representing Randy Archiquette on multiple Felony DUI charges has indicated that Archiquette will plead guilty before trial but it is still not been disclosed what charges the accused will plead to. According to Charles Traina, the assistant public defender handling the case, negotiations are on-going in the DUI manslaughter cases but there is no decision imminent on his plea or his client’s sentnce.

The DUI trial of Archiquette was set to begin October 18 but according to TBO.com, the website of the Tampa Tribune, prosecutors were seeking to delay the start of the trial. The Hillsborough County judge overseeing the trial warned both the prosecution and the defense that any plea would have to include specific Florida DUI penalties. Judge Thomas P. Barber warned he would not accept any plea that did not include minimum and maximum sentencing recommendations. The plea is set to be entered in front of Barber November 8.

The 40-year-old Riverview man was charged with two counts of DUI manslaughter and vehicular homicide following two separate fatal DUI crashes. He is facing other charges as well associated with the crash that involved four vehicles when all was said and done. Both fatalities took place in a 30-minute span killing two women.  Archiquette has been in jail since his DUI arrest in April of 2009. He is being held without bail after allegedly causing the deaths of a 69-year-old woman and a 20-year-old woman.

TBO.com reported that Archiquette’s blood-alcohol-level was 0.147, which is nearly twice the legal limit in Florida, which is 0.08. While driving his 2007 Chevrolet Yukon, Archiquette is accused of rear-ending a tractor-trailer on Adamo Drive and then he side-swiped a car before rear-ending a second vehicle. At that point he is alleged to have struck a car head-on killing the driver.
